1. Hope Village Market

This local market, located at 14150 Woodrow Wilson Street in Detroit, is only about a mile from Highland Park. This convenient location makes Hope Village a great market to walk to. Held every Wednesday from June through September, the market also offers music, performances, and more. Hope Village is also the perfect local produce market for anyone who wants to support local businesses, as the market is committed to supporting black-owned entrepreneurs.

2. Fresh Valley Fruit Market

You can find Fresh Valley at 3011 Caniff Street in neighboring Hamtramck, this market offers much more than just fresh fruits and vegetables. Fresh Valley is also an Asian grocery store that offers Middle-Eastern staples and fresh meats, such as goat. This market participates in Doordash delivery, which means that you are able to have your fresh produce delivered, a perfect option if you are too busy to make a run to the store.

3. Oakland Avenue Urban Farm

This urban farm, located at 9227 Goodwin Street, hosts a weekly market on Saturdays. The farm produces over 30 varieties of organic fruits and vegetables, as well as tea, eggs, jams, and spices. Oakland Avenue Farm also provides a helpful service that they call Harvest on Demand. This allows you to order your produce ahead of time and pick it up at the Community House outside of the regular market hours.

4. Peaches & Greens Produce Market

This community-based market has been operating for 15 years. You will find their store at 8838 3rd Ave in Detroit, just a couple of miles from Highland Park. Alongside its brick-and-mortar premises and delivery options, this produce market also offers online shopping and operates a food truck that sells its fresh products.

5. Brother Nature Produce

This market is located about seven miles away from Highland Park at 2913 Rosa Parks Blvd. in Detroit. Brother Nature is open on Tuesdays and Thursdays. They specialize in herbs and salad greens, so make sure to stop here to stock up on your cooking essentials like thyme and basil.
